| The spDerivation property is used to:
Get the key derivation function used to hash an item of type "Password". This property can be used for items of type "Password" defined in the data model editor or programmatically.
Set the key derivation function used for hashing (only for "Password" items defined programmatically).... |

| The spLength property is used to:
Get the hash output length. This property can be used for items of type "Password" defined in the data model editor or programmatically.
Set the hash output length (only for "Password" items defined programmatically).... |

| The spIterationCount property is used to:
Get the iteration count of the hash algorithm used for an item of type "Password". This property can be used for items of type "Password" defined in the data model editor or programmatically.
Sets the iteration count of the hash algorithm used for an item of type "Password" (only for "Password" items described programmatically).... |

| The spHash property is used to:
Get the algorithm used for salting an item of type "Password". This property can be used for items of type "Password" defined in the data model editor or programmatically.
Set the algorithm used for salting (only for "Password" items described programmatically).... |
